In developing nations such as India, diseases like dengue, malaria typhoid are endemic and often manifest as acute undifferentiated fever. In areas where multiple infectious agents coexist, the incidence of co‐infections is higher. In tropical regions, seasonal variations increase the risk of individuals being co‐infected with dengue and other infectious diseases such as rickettsia, malaria enteric fever. This study aimed to examine the association of co‐infections in children diagnosed with dengue. In this retrospective hospital‐based study, case records of all patients diagnosed with dengue and admitted during this period were reviewed. The study included patients admitted to ward and ICU who tested positive for NS1, IgM, or IgG. Patients with dengue‐like symptoms but serologically negative were excluded. A total of 245 patients were admitted with serologically confirmed dengue during the study period. Of these, 143 (58.37%) were female and 102 (41.63%) were male, 215 (87.76%) were from rural areas 30 (12.24%) were from urban areas. Among the 245 patients, 33 had co‐infections. Of these, 19 (57.58%) had enteric fever, 8 (24.24%) had malarial fever, 3 (9.09%) had rickettsial fever 2 (6.06%) had urinary tract infections (UTIs). Co‐infection was more frequent in patients with dengue with warning signs and severe dengue, which was statistically significant (p<0.05). Children with co‐infections had longer hospital stays mortality was higher among patients with severe dengue and co‐infections. Co‐infections with enteric fever, malaria, rickettsia UTIs are not uncommon in patients with dengue fever. Children with co‐infections present with more severe dengue and have extended hospital stays.
